Nutritional Profile
Flour tortillas offer a balanced nutritional profile, providing a significant source of carbohydrates, protein, and fiber. A single 6-inch tortilla contains approximately 159 calories, 4.3 grams of protein, 3.5 grams of fat, 27 grams of carbohydrates, and 1.6 grams of fiber. The presence of dietary fiber contributes to a feeling of fullness and can aid in maintaining a healthy digestive system.

Preparation and Storage
Preparing flour tortillas is a relatively simple process. Combine the flour, water, and salt in a bowl and mix until a dough forms. Knead the dough for several minutes until it becomes smooth and elastic. Divide the dough into equal portions and roll out each portion into a thin circle. Cook the tortillas on a hot griddle or comal until they are golden brown and slightly puffed up.
Store flour tortillas in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. For longer storage, they can be frozen for up to 2 months. Thaw frozen tortillas in the refrigerator overnight before using.
